This is an application for bail in connection with Gaighat P.S.Case No. 193/2016 registered for the offences punishable under sections 272 and 273 of the Indian Penal Code and 30(a), 35(a) of the Bihar Prohibition and Excise Act. Allegation as per F.I.R. is of recovery of 1113 litres of liquor from a vehicle and the name of the petitioner was disclosed by the other accused.
Submission of the learned counsel for the petitioner is that nothing has been recovered from the possession of the petitioner and though he is accused in nine other cases of similar nature but in some of them he is on bail and now he is in custody since 14.7.2017.
Heard learned A.P.P. also.
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.48346 of 2017 (2) dt.12-10-2017 Having heard both sides and in view of the allegation as well as criminal antecedent of the petitioner, I am not inclined to grant bail to the petitioner. This application is, accordingly, dismissed.
However, the trial court is directed to expedite the trial of the petitioner and conduct the trial on day to day basis so as to complete the trial within a period of further six months. If the trial is not concluded within the said period, the petitioner is at liberty to renew his prayer for bail before the trial court which shall be considered on its own merits.
